.banner{align-items:center;display:flex;justify-content:center;margin-bottom:25px;padding-top:25px}.banner img{display:block;height:auto;width:100%}.banner-tablet-gads{display:none}.banner-tablet{align-items:center;display:none;justify-content:center;margin-bottom:30px}.banner-tablet__wrapper{aspect-ratio:728/90;background-color:#ddd}.banner-tablet img{height:auto;width:100%}.banner-mobile{align-items:center;aspect-ratio:300/250;background-color:#ddd;display:none;justify-content:center}.banner-mobile img{height:auto;width:100%}.dpc-pagination{display:flex;justify-content:center;margin-top:60px}.dpc-pagination.pagination-mob{display:none}.dpc-pagination .page-numbers{align-items:center;background-color:#f5f8ff;border-radius:50px;display:flex;font-size:18px;height:58px;justify-content:center;margin:0 3px;text-decoration:none;transition:.2s;width:58px}.dpc-pagination .page-numbers:hover{background-color:#e7eeff}.dpc-pagination .next{margin-left:13px}.dpc-pagination .prev{margin-right:13px}.dpc-pagination .prev svg{transform:rotate(-180deg)}.dpc-pagination .next,.dpc-pagination .prev{background-color:transparent;border:1px solid transparent}.dpc-pagination .next:hover,.dpc-pagination .prev:hover{background-color:transparent;border:1px solid #dce6fd}.dpc-pagination .next svg,.dpc-pagination .prev svg{height:17px;transition:.2s;width:19px}.dpc-pagination .next svg path,.dpc-pagination .prev svg path{fill:var(--main-bg-color);transition:.2s}.dpc-pagination .disabled{background-color:transparent;pointer-events:none}.dpc-pagination .disabled svg path{fill:#e4e4e4}.dpc-pagination .current{background-color:var(--main-bg-color);color:#fff;pointer-events:none}.pagination-links__list{display:none}.categories .sticky{position:relative!important;top:0}.categories .page-banner__second{display:block!important}.categories .trending__tabs{margin-bottom:0!important}.banner-tablet{border-bottom:1px solid #e1e5f6;margin-bottom:20px;padding-bottom:20px}h1{color:#17283c!important;font-size:40px;font-weight:600;line-height:48px;margin-bottom:30px}.category:has(.tags_empty) h1{margin-bottom:0}.page-category{padding-top:150px}.page-category__pagination{display:flex;justify-content:center;margin-bottom:60px;margin-top:60px;width:100%}.page-category__pagination .dpc-pagination{margin-top:0}.page-category__bottom,.page-category__top{width:100%}.page-category__bottom .banner{margin:60px auto;padding:0}.page-category__main{display:flex;gap:30px;justify-content:space-between}.page-category__inner{max-width:1100px;position:relative;width:100%}.page-category__inner .post-item:first-child{align-items:center;border-bottom:0;display:flex;height:374px;justify-content:center;margin-bottom:60px;padding:0;position:relative}.page-category__inner .post-item:first-child:hover img{transform:scale(1.05)}.page-category__inner .post-item:first-child:hover .post-title{text-decoration:underline;text-decoration-thickness:1px;text-underline-offset:2px}.page-category__inner .post-item:first-child .post-thumbnail{border-radius:20px;height:374px;left:0;max-width:100%;position:absolute;top:0;width:100%}.page-category__inner .post-item:first-child .post-thumbnail:before{background-color:#000;border-radius:20px;content:"";display:block;height:100%;opacity:.45;pointer-events:none;position:absolute;width:100%;z-index:2}.page-category__inner .post-item:first-child .post-thumbnail a{border-radius:20px;inset:0;position:absolute;width:100%;z-index:1}.page-category__inner .post-item:first-child .post-thumbnail a img{border-radius:20px}.page-category__inner .post-item:first-child .post-item-texts{color:#fff;margin:-2px 0 0;max-width:659px;padding:0 10px;position:relative;text-align:center;z-index:2}.page-category__inner .post-item:first-child .post-item-texts .panel-category{margin:0 auto 18px}.page-category__inner .post-item:first-child .post-item-texts .panel-category:hover+a.post-title{text-decoration:none!important}.page-category__inner .post-item:first-child .post-item-texts .post-excerpt{display:none}.page-category__inner .post-item:first-child .post-item-texts .post-title{color:#fff;font-size:40px;line-height:48px;margin-bottom:22px;transition:.2s}.page-category__inner .post-item:last-child{border-bottom:none;margin-bottom:0;padding-bottom:0}.page-category__previews{padding-top:30px;position:relative}.page-category__previews .post-thumbnail{position:relative}.page-category__previews .post-thumbnail .initial-controls{bottom:unset;left:unset;pointer-events:none;right:28px;top:28px;transform:none}.page-category__previews .post-thumbnail .initial-controls .play-pause-button .icon{max-width:53px}.page-category__side-wrapper{flex-shrink:0;padding-top:30px;width:300px}.page-categoty__inner-banner,.page-categoty__inner-banner-second{display:none}.post-item{border-bottom:1px solid #e1e5f6;display:flex;margin-bottom:20px;padding-bottom:20px;width:100%}.post-item .post-meta span:nth-child(2):before{background:#17283c}.post-item:first-child .post-thumbnail a{max-height:100%}.post-item:first-child .post-meta{justify-content:center}.post-item:first-child .post-meta span:nth-child(2):before{background:#fff!important}.post-thumbnail{display:flex;flex-shrink:0;max-width:381px;min-height:233px;width:100%}.post-thumbnail a{border-radius:10px;max-height:233px;overflow:hidden;width:100%}.post-thumbnail a img{border-radius:12px;height:100%;-o-object-fit:cover;object-fit:cover;transition:.3s;width:100%}.post-thumbnail a:hover img{transform:scale(1.05)}.post-item-texts{display:flex;flex-direction:column;margin-left:20px;padding-top:16px}.post-item-texts .panel-category,.post-title{margin-bottom:15px}.post-title{color:var(--main-bg-color);font-size:25px;font-weight:700;line-height:30px;text-decoration:none;transition:.2s}.post-title:hover{text-decoration:underline;text-decoration-thickness:1px;text-underline-offset:2px}.post-excerpt{-webkit-box-orient:vertical;-webkit-line-clamp:3;line-clamp:3;display:-webkit-box;font-size:16px;line-height:22px;margin-bottom:15px;max-height:66px;overflow:hidden}.post-meta{font-size:14px;line-height:17px}.sidebar__news{display:flex;flex-direction:column;padding-top:25px;width:100%}.sidebar__news h2{color:var(--main-bg-color);font-size:30px;margin-bottom:25px}.sidebar__post{border-bottom:1px solid #e1e5f6;display:flex;flex-direction:column;margin-bottom:25px;padding-bottom:25px}.sidebar__post:last-child{border-bottom:0;margin-bottom:0}.sidebar__post .panel-category{margin-bottom:15px}.sidebar__post .sidebar__post-title{font-size:18px;font-weight:600;line-height:22px;margin-bottom:15px;transition:.2s}.sidebar__post .sidebar__post-title:hover{text-decoration:underline;text-decoration-thickness:1px;text-underline-offset:2px}.before-loading{left:50%;position:absolute;top:50%;transform:translateX(-50%)}@media (max-width:1440px){.page-category__pagination{margin-bottom:50px;margin-top:50px}.page-category__top h1{margin-bottom:22px}.page-category__bottom .banner{margin:50px auto}.page-category__inner .post-item:first-child{height:300px;margin-bottom:30px}.page-category__inner .post-item:first-child .post-thumbnail{height:300px}}@media screen and (max-width:1281px){.post-thumbnail{max-width:325px;min-height:225px}}@media (max-width:1250px){.post-item-texts{padding-top:0}}@media (max-width:1024px){.banner{margin-bottom:0;padding-bottom:40px;padding-top:40px}.banner-tablet-gads{align-items:center;display:flex;justify-content:center}.banner-tablet{display:flex}.dpc-pagination{margin-top:40px}.page-category__inner .post-item.before-banner-post-item{border-bottom:none;margin-bottom:0;padding-bottom:0}}@media screen and (max-width:1024px){.categories{overflow-x:hidden;width:100%}.archive .subscription{margin-bottom:40px}.page-category__side-wrapper,.page-category__side-wrapper .sidebar__news{display:none}.page-category__side-wrapper .page-banner__first{margin-bottom:20px}.page-category__inner{margin-right:0;padding-left:0;position:relative}.page-category__inner .page-categoty__inner-banner{display:none}.page-category__bottom .banner{margin:40px auto}.page-category__previews{padding-top:30px}.page-category__previews .post-item{border-bottom:1px solid #e1e5f6;display:flex;margin-bottom:20px;padding-bottom:20px;width:100%}.page-category__previews .post-item:first-child{height:307px;margin-bottom:45px;max-width:100%}.page-category__previews .post-item:first-child:hover img{transform:scale(1.05)}.page-category__previews .post-item:first-child .post-thumbnail{height:307px}.page-category__previews .post-item:first-child .post-item-texts{margin:10px 0 0}.page-category__previews .post-item:first-child .post-item-texts .panel-category{margin:0 auto 18px}.page-category__previews .post-item:first-child .post-item-texts .post-title{color:#fff;font-size:30px;line-height:36px;margin-bottom:22px}.page-category__previews .post-item:last-child{border-bottom:none;margin-bottom:0}.page-category__pagination{margin-bottom:40px;margin-top:40px}h1{margin-bottom:20px}.post-thumbnail{height:166px;max-width:272px;min-height:166px}.post-title{font-size:18px;line-height:21px;margin-bottom:15px}.post-item-texts{margin-left:13px;padding-top:0}.post-item-texts .panel-category{margin-bottom:15px;margin-top:-4px}.post-excerpt{-webkit-box-orient:vertical;-webkit-line-clamp:2;line-clamp:2;display:-webkit-box;font-size:16px;margin-bottom:15px;max-height:44px;overflow:hidden}}@media (max-width:900px){.pagination-desk{display:none}.dpc-pagination.pagination-mob{display:flex}}@media (max-width:767px){.banner{align-items:center;display:flex;justify-content:center;padding:20px 20px 24px}.banner-tablet-gads .block-banner-subpage__tablet{display:none}.banner-tablet-gads .block-banner-subpage__mobile{display:block}.banner-tablet{display:none}.banner-mobile{align-items:center;display:flex;justify-content:center;margin:0 auto 20px;max-width:300px}.banner-mobile img{height:auto;width:100%}.dpc-pagination .page-numbers{font-size:16px!important;height:38px;max-height:38px;min-width:38px;width:38px}.dpc-pagination .next{margin-left:7px}.dpc-pagination .prev{margin-right:7px}.page-category__inner .post-item.post-indent-mob{margin-bottom:330px}.banner-tablet-gads_mid{margin:25px auto}.banner-tablet{display:flex}h1{font-size:30px;line-height:36px}.page-category__inner{padding-bottom:0}.page-category__side-wrapper{top:278px}.page-category__bottom{padding-bottom:0}.page-category__previews .post-item{flex-direction:column;margin-bottom:20px;max-width:100%;padding-bottom:20px}.page-category__previews .post-item:first-child{height:256px;margin-bottom:330px}.page-category__previews .post-item:first-child .post-thumbnail{height:256px}.page-category__previews .post-item:first-child .post-item-texts{margin:-4px 0 0}.page-category__previews .post-item:first-child .post-item-texts a{padding:0 10px}.page-category__previews .post-item .post-thumbnail{height:197px;max-width:100%;width:100%}.page-category__previews .post-item .post-item-texts{margin-left:0;padding-left:0;padding-right:0;padding-top:15px}.page-category__previews .post-item .post-item-texts .panel-category{height:26px;margin-bottom:10px;margin-top:0}.page-category__previews .post-item .post-excerpt{-webkit-line-clamp:3;line-clamp:3;font-size:14px;line-height:19px;margin-bottom:10px;max-height:57px}.page-category__previews.no-mob-banner .post-item:first-child{margin-bottom:20px}.page-category__previews.no-mob-banner .post-item:last-child{margin-bottom:0}.page-categoty__inner-banner-second{display:flex;justify-content:center;left:50%;position:absolute;top:326px;transform:translateX(-50%);width:100%}.dpc-pagination{margin-top:27px;padding-top:0}.page-category__previews .post-thumbnail .initial-controls{right:15px;top:15px}.page-category__previews .post-thumbnail .initial-controls .play-pause-button .icon{max-width:50px}}@media (max-width:700px){.banner{padding:15px}}@media (max-width:501px){.subscription{margin-top:0}.page-category__previews .post-item:first-child .post-item-texts .post-title{font-size:26px}}@media (max-width:419px){.dpc-pagination .next,.dpc-pagination .prev{margin:0 3px!important}.page-numbers{height:30px!important;max-height:30px!important;min-width:30px!important;width:30px!important}.page-category__previews .post-item:first-child .post-item-texts .post-title{font-feature-settings:"liga" off;-webkit-box-orient:vertical;-webkit-line-clamp:3;line-clamp:3;display:-webkit-box;height:94px;line-height:120%;max-height:94px;overflow:hidden;text-decoration:none;text-overflow:ellipsis}}